Output 8255fe51b2bb271e6fffa3081aad0c4fe657aee2425affee16c3d8e48a35178d:0

value
13824400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d570f5b29f67baf85d7c562a887b6b57bc7c2344 OP_EQUAL
address
3M9bAz6EfCYqsh8KZtwQu48YZFM4RmCw7d
transaction
8255fe51b2bb271e6fffa3081aad0c4fe657aee2425affee16c3d8e48a35178d
confirmations
463687
spent
true